Completely unable to connect to USG60 Firewall
I'm trying to connect to a used USG60 Firewall I bought about a month ago. It shows up on my network, but I'm completely unable to connect to the network interface. I've tried factory resetting it about 4 times now with no changes.

Let's start with some initial troubleshooting steps to help resolve your issue.
- Check for IP conflicts: Please try isolating your USG60 firewall by directly connecting the LAN port (Port 4 for the initial setup) to your PC. The default IP address should be
192.168.1.1
. Also, ensure the firewall has been properly reset before attempting access. - Factory Reset: To reset the device, press and hold the reset button for approximately 5 seconds or until the SYS LED begins blinking. This will restore the firewall to its default settings.
If you're still unable to access the firewall, could you please provide us with the following information?
- Connect your firewall's LAN port to your PC, scan your network using the ZON utility, and see if you can access the firewall's web GUI through the IP that ZON discovers.
- What is the current status of the device's LED indicators?
- Could you describe your network topology? Specifically, what devices are connected to the firewall?
